- UI interaktif yang berfokus pada review, open-source untuk memeriksa perubahan kode yang dihasilkan agen di terminal, dibangun di atas OpenTUI dan Pierre diffs
- Fitur khas Hunk yang unik: menampilkan komentar AI/agen inline langsung di samping kode
- Stream review multi-file dan navigasi sidebar untuk menjelajahi perubahan di banyak file dalam sekali pandang
- Menyediakan split, stack, dan layout otomatis responsif, serta mode watch untuk auto-reload saat file berubah
- Mencerminkan perintah bergaya Git diff apa adanya, tetapi memeriksa perubahan di UI review alih-alih teks
hunk diff untuk perubahan saat ini, hunk show untuk review commit, hunk diff --watch untuk auto-reload
- Saat diintegrasikan dengan agen, jalankan Hunk di terminal terpisah lalu muat Hunk review skill untuk melakukan review dalam sesi live
Load the Hunk skill and use it for this review.
- Jika dikonfigurasi dengan
git config --global core.pager "hunk pager", maka git diff dan git show akan otomatis terbuka di Hunk
- Komponen HunkDiffView dipublikasikan sebagai
hunkdiff/opentui, sehingga renderer diff bisa di-embed ke aplikasi OpenTUI buatan sendiri
- Mendukung kustomisasi pengaturan melalui config.toml, seperti tema (graphite, midnight, paper, ember) dan mode (auto, split, stack)
- Lisensi MIT
1 komentar
Alat-alat yang sudah ada sedang berevolusi untuk mengakomodasi coding agentik
Menyenangkan karena komentar yang ditambahkan AI pada isi diff bisa ditampilkan